Output 50db8ff099f9f3023c5e5d9ee8fe8553fc3849e495d244b095bc3d00be711ac6:0

value
18650078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a8c5cb028e42b182f57726f340e347de0d8e4a6 OP_EQUAL
address
MEhLP9p6io7hFeSKn61MLAGJS26w7vMnFz
transaction
50db8ff099f9f3023c5e5d9ee8fe8553fc3849e495d244b095bc3d00be711ac6
spent
true